| Computer Science |
Credits: |
| CSCI 125 |
Computer Programming I |
3 |
| CSCI 185 |
Computer Programming II |
3 |
| |
|
Total: 6 Credits |
| |
| Physics |
Credits: |
| PHYS 170 |
General Physics I |
4 |
| PHYS 180 |
General Physics II |
4 |
| |
|
Total: 8 Credits |
| |
| General Electives |
Credits: |
|
Consult with advisor on all liberal arts electives. |
18 |
| |
| Restricted Electives |
Credits: |
|
STEM Elective in Math, Physics, Engineering, or Computing Sciences |
3 |
|
Math, Computer Science, or Science Elective |
3 |
| |
|
Total: 6 Credits |
|
Electives must be at 300-level and above. Consult with advisor on all elective choices. |
| |
| Mathematics Requirement (all concentrations) |
Credits: |
| MATH 170 |
Calculus I |
4 |
| MATH 180 |
Calculus II |
4 |
| MATH 220 |
Probability and Statistics |
3 |
| MATH 260 |
Calculus III |
4 |
| MATH 300 |
Mathematical Methods for Data Science |
3 |
| MATH 310 |
Linear Algebra |
3 |
| MATH 320 |
Differential Equations |
3 |
| MATH 340 |
Introduction to Mathematical Reasoning |
3 |
| MATH 350 |
Advanced Calculus |
3 |
| MATH 410 |
Numerical Linear Algebra |
3 |
| MATH 495 |
Mathematical Modeling |
3 |
| MATH XXX |
Choose between MATH 400 Elements of Modern Analysis or MATH 370 Real Analysis |
3 |
| |
|
Total: 39 Credits |
Concentration Options:
Students may choose between General Concentration, Mathematical Modeling, or Scientific Computation. |
| |
| General Concentration |
Credits: |
| MATH 45X |
Choose between MATH 450 Partial Differential Equations and MATH 455 Numerical Analysis |
3 |
| MATH 3XX |
Math elective must be at 300-level and above. Consult with advisor on all elective choices. |
3 |
|
Science Elective |
4 |
|
Computer Science Elective |
3 |
|
Computer Science or Science Elective Choice |
6 |
| |
| Mathematical Modeling Concentration |
Credits: |
| MATH 450 |
Partial Differential Equations |
3 |
| MATH 470 |
Mathematical Fluid Dynamics |
3 |
| PHYS 225 |
Introduction to Modern Physics |
3 |
| PHYS 226 |
Introduction to Modern Physics Laboratory |
1 |
| PHYS 450 |
Mathematical Physics |
3 |
|
Computer Science Elective |
3 |
|
Computer Science or Science Elective Choice |
3 |
| |
| Scientific Computation Concentration |
Credits: |
| CSCI 235 |
Elements of Discrete Structures |
3 |
| CSCI 312 |
Theory of Computations |
3 |
| CSCI 335 |
Design and Analysis of Algorithms |
3 |
| MATH 440 |
Numerical Optimization |
3 |
| MATH 455 |
Numerical Analysis |
3 |
|
Science Elective |
4 |
| |